Is 959 789 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 959 789 is about 979.688.

Thus, the square root of 959 789 is not an integer, and therefore 959 789 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 959 789?

The square of a number (here 959 789) is the result of the product of this number (959 789) by itself (i.e., 959 789 × 959 789); the square of 959 789 is sometimes called "raising 959 789 to the power 2", or "959 789 squared".

The square of 959 789 is 921 194 924 521 because 959 789 × 959 789 = 959 7892 = 921 194 924 521.

As a consequence, 959 789 is the square root of 921 194 924 521.
